My husband and I bought a used car a year and half ago from this place, and we are 80% sure we were sold a lemon.
At the start, it was rough. We went in with a listing and test drove it. It was fine and we were completely content. The sales person told us to come back with the check and the car is ours. I followed up a few days after, to make sure everything is right, which much to my surprise, the sales person didn t pick up the phone. When my husband and I made accommodations in our work schedule to pick up the car, we were told we couldn t drive off with the car. In reality and what our sales person failed to tell us, we drop off the check and pick up the car a day or two later. Hmm, that should ve been a warning sign. When I spoke the manager at the time, I told him I called and left a message to the sales person, the guy said he never got it. So, the sale guy is now playing us for a sale. Needless to say, I was infuriated but also frustrated at the possibility of starting the car searching process over again. So we bought the car.
Recently, after owning the car a little over a year, our front right wheel stopped working, it actually fell off. When we took it into the shop, the mechanic was like someone put in the wrong bolt on the wheel axis, had this happened on the highway, it would ve been deadly. This explains why our tires were always low on air as well, a warning sign that my husband and I weren t aware of. Not two weeks later, we needed to get the shock mounts replaced, which isn t an usual repair but definitely not uncommon. NOW our check engine light is on, and I can t believe to image what else is going on.
A few things within the first year we noticed, there was some weird asphalt on the driver side which we stupidly missed during our test drive. Then after all of these hidden problems are arising, I ve come to the conclusion that the previous owner probably had an accident, got it fixed without it ending up on the report and this dealership did nothing to guarantee the car s safety. We have definitely learned our lesson next time we buy a car, but I'm incredibly disappointed I could've easily ended up in a terrible accident because this place didn't check if all the parts were correct for the next owner.
